Understanding the Role of Gravel Filter Media

The support gravel acts as the foundation of your filtration tank’s lower layer. It enables uniform water distribution across the entire cross-section of the vessel, prevents fine media migration, and minimizes channeling during both service and regeneration cycles. Proper installation of this media ensures that the subsequent filtration stages work as designed, optimizing water quality and system lifespan.

1. Measure and Mark

Determine the depth required for the gravel layer, typically enough to form a stable, free-flowing foundation. Use measurements consistent with your tank’s specifications, ensuring the support layer does not impede flow or restrict headspace.

2. Adding the Gravel

  • Start by pouring the double-scrubbed gravel evenly across the bottom of the tank.
  • Ensure a uniform distribution, avoiding clumps and gaps that could lead to uneven support.
  • If necessary, gently level the gravel using a rake or similar tool to promote stability.

3. Confirming the Layer Depth and Distribution

Check that the gravel layer is consistent at the desired depth. It should support the finer media layers above while allowing unrestricted upward flow.

Layering the Fine Media

Once the support gravel is in place, proceed with adding the finer media materials, such as filter sand, carbon, or anthracite. The support gravel will ensure these layers are evenly supported and that flow distribution remains uniform, enhancing overall filtration efficiency.

Final System Checks and Startup

  • Inspection: Verify that the gravel is evenly distributed and properly seated. Confirm there are no gaps or high spots that could cause channeling.
  • Backwash and Flush: Perform an initial backwash to remove any loose particles or dust. This process helps achieve clear rinse water at startup and prepares the system for operation.
  • Monitoring: During the initial system run, monitor flow rates and headloss to ensure the gravel layer is performing as expected.

Maintenance and Long-Term Performance

Over time, sediment and biological buildup may occur. Regular backwashing helps maintain the integrity of the gravel support layer, preventing channeling and ensuring even flow distribution. The high purity and graded size of the gravel help prevent turbidity and off-color rinse water, supporting consistent water quality.

Pre-treatment and filtration order

The sequence of treatment stages in a water filtration system is crucial for achieving optimal water quality. Proper pre-treatment ensures that larger particles and sediments are removed before they can interfere with finer filtration processes. For instance, introducing the Nelsen Corporation 1/2x1/4 Gravel Filter Media as a foundational layer allows for the effective trapping of larger debris while enabling the smooth flow of water through subsequent media layers. This initial stage prevents clogging and extends the life of finer filtration materials.

Moreover, the order of filtration stages influences the overall efficiency of the system. When coarser materials are placed at the bottom, they provide structural support and allow for a gradual transition to finer media above. This arrangement mitigates issues such as channeling, where water takes the path of least resistance, thus bypassing effective filtration. Implementing an effective pre-treatment strategy not only enhances the performance of the filtration system but also ensures that the treated water meets the necessary quality standards for household use.
